StoryTrek XR now available to 杏吧原创 instructors

StoryTrek is the Hyperlab's own locative media authoring platform. Designed for spatial storytelling, it allows users to create media rich, site-specific stories, locative games, environmental tours, and open-air museums and installations that can be experienced either from a web browser or a mobile device.
